586 Open Source Deep Reinforcement Learning Software Projects
Free and open source deep reinforcement learning code projects including engines, APIs, generators, and tools.
Ml From Scratch 20728 ⭐
Machine Learning From Scratch. Bare bones NumPy implementations of machine learning models and algorithms with a focus on accessibility. Aims to cover everything from linear regression to deep learning.
Airsim 12597 ⭐
Open source simulator for autonomous vehicles built on Unreal Engine / Unity, from Microsoft AI & Research
Deep Learning Drizzle 9824 ⭐
Drench yourself in Deep Learning, Reinforcement Learning, Machine Learning, Computer Vision, and NLP by learning from these exciting lectures!!
Mit Deep Learning 8949 ⭐
Tutorials, assignments, and competitions for MIT Deep Learning related courses.
Udacity Deep Reinforcement Learning 4033 ⭐
Repo for the Deep Reinforcement Learning Nanodegree program
Andri27 Ts Reinforcement Learning 3345 ⭐
Learn Deep Reinforcement Learning in 60 days! Lectures & Code in Python. Reinforcement Learning + Deep Learning
Deep_reinforcement_learning_course 3252 ⭐
Implementations from the free course Deep Reinforcement Learning with Tensorflow and PyTorch
Pytorch A2c Ppo Acktr Gail 2656 ⭐
PyTorch implementation of Advantage Actor Critic (A2C), Proximal Policy Optimization (PPO), Scalable trust-region method for deep reinforcement learning using Kronecker-factored approximation (ACKTR) and Generative Adversarial Imitation Learning (GAIL).
Minimalrl 2071 ⭐
Implementations of basic RL algorithms with minimal lines of codes! (pytorch based)
Deeptraffic 1535 ⭐
DeepTraffic is a deep reinforcement learning competition, part of the MIT Deep Learning series.
Noreward Rl 1256 ⭐
[ICML 2017] TensorFlow code for Curiosity-driven Exploration for Deep Reinforcement Learning
Deep Reinforcement Learning With Pytorch 1940 ⭐
PyTorch implementation of DQN, AC, ACER, A2C, A3C, PG, DDPG, TRPO, PPO, SAC, TD3 and ....
Awesome System For Machine Learning 1502 ⭐
A curated list of research in machine learning systems (MLSys). Paper notes are also provided.
Ikostrikov Pytorch A3c 959 ⭐
PyTorch implementation of Asynchronous Advantage Actor Critic (A3C) from "Asynchronous Methods for Deep Reinforcement Learning".
Slm Lab 1005 ⭐
Modular Deep Reinforcement Learning framework in PyTorch. Companion library of the book "Foundations of Deep Reinforcement Learning".
Pygame Learning Environment 877 ⭐
PyGame Learning Environment (PLE) -- Reinforcement Learning Environment in Python.
Rlcard 1563 ⭐
Reinforcement Learning / AI Bots in Card (Poker) Games - Blackjack, Leduc, Texas, DouDizhu, Mahjong, UNO.
Deeprl Tutorials 851 ⭐
Contains high quality implementations of Deep Reinforcement Learning algorithms written in PyTorch
Softlearning 864 ⭐
Softlearning is a reinforcement learning framework for training maximum entropy policies in continuous domains. Includes the official implementation of the Soft Actor-Critic algorithm.
Hands On Reinforcement Learning With Python 714 ⭐
Master Reinforcement and Deep Reinforcement Learning using OpenAI Gym and TensorFlow
Deepdrive 719 ⭐
Deepdrive is a simulator that allows anyone with a PC to push the state-of-the-art in self-driving
Pytorch Rl 765 ⭐
PyTorch implementation of Deep Reinforcement Learning: Policy Gradient methods (TRPO, PPO, A2C) and Generative Adversarial Imitation Learning (GAIL). Fast Fisher vector product TRPO.
Trending Deep Learning 563 ⭐
Top 100 trending deep learning repositories sorted by the number of stars gained on a specific day.
Dissecting Reinforcement Learning 530 ⭐
Python code, PDFs and resources for the series of posts on Reinforcement Learning which I published on my personal blog
Habitat Lab 766 ⭐
A modular high-level library to train embodied AI agents across a variety of tasks, environments, and simulators.
Visual Pushing Grasping 611 ⭐
Train robotic agents to learn to plan pushing and grasping actions for manipulation with deep reinforcement learning.
Rl Portfolio Management 474 ⭐
Attempting to replicate "A Deep Reinforcement Learning Framework for the Financial Portfolio Management Problem" https://arxiv.org/abs/1706.10059 (and an openai gym environment)
Reinforcement_learning_tutorial_with_demo 515 ⭐
Reinforcement Learning Tutorial with Demo: DP (Policy and Value Iteration), Monte Carlo, TD Learning (SARSA, QLearning), Function Approximation, Policy Gradient, DQN, Imitation, Meta Learning, Papers, Courses, etc..
Tf_chatbot_seq2seq_antilm 367 ⭐
Seq2seq chatbot with attention and anti-language model to suppress generic response, option for further improve by deep reinforcement learning.
Autonomous Learning Library 531 ⭐
A PyTorch library for building deep reinforcement learning agents.
Lagom 366 ⭐
lagom: A PyTorch infrastructure for rapid prototyping of reinforcement learning algorithms.
Navneet Nmk Pytorch Rl 411 ⭐
This repository contains model-free deep reinforcement learning algorithms implemented in Pytorch
Reinforcement Learning Algorithms 487 ⭐
This repository contains most of pytorch implementation based classic deep reinforcement learning algorithms, including - DQN, DDQN, Dueling Network, DDPG, SAC, A2C, PPO, TRPO. (More algorithms are still in progress)
Openai_lab 320 ⭐
An experimentation framework for Reinforcement Learning using OpenAI Gym, Tensorflow, and Keras.
Ai Economist 744 ⭐
Foundation is a flexible, modular, and composable framework to model socio-economic behaviors and dynamics with both agents and governments. This framework can be used in conjunction with reinforcement learning to learn optimal economic policies, as done by the AI Economist (https://www.einstein.ai/the-ai-economist).
Neural Symbolic Machines 344 ⭐
Neural Symbolic Machines is a framework to integrate neural networks and symbolic representations using reinforcement learning, with applications in program synthesis and semantic parsing.
Reward Learning Rl 330 ⭐
[RSS 2019] End-to-End Robotic Reinforcement Learning without Reward Engineering
Kaixhin Atari 260 ⭐
Persistent advantage learning dueling double DQN for the Arcade Learning Environment
Mishalaskin Curl 422 ⭐
CURL: Contrastive Unsupervised Representation Learning for Sample-Efficient Reinforcement Learning
Drl_based_selfdrivingcarcontrol 265 ⭐
Deep Reinforcement Learning (DQN) based Self Driving Car Control with Vehicle Simulator
Crypto Rl 497 ⭐
Deep Reinforcement Learning toolkit: record and replay cryptocurrency limit order book data & train a DDQN agent
Kaixhin Planet 282 ⭐
Deep Planning Network: Control from pixels by latent planning with learned dynamics
Gym Gazebo2 295 ⭐
gym-gazebo2 is a toolkit for developing and comparing reinforcement learning algorithms using ROS 2 and Gazebo
Machine Learning UIuc 240 ⭐
🖥️ CS446: Machine Learning in Spring 2018, University of Illinois at Urbana-Champaign
Applied Reinforcement Learning 248 ⭐
Reinforcement Learning and Decision Making tutorials explained at an intuitive level and with Jupyter Notebooks
Deeprl Tensorflow2 434 ⭐
🐋 Simple implementations of various popular Deep Reinforcement Learning algorithms using TensorFlow2
Learning To Communicate Pytorch 268 ⭐
Learning to Communicate with Deep Multi-Agent Reinforcement Learning in PyTorch
Starcraft 623 ⭐
Implementations of IQL, QMIX, VDN, COMA, QTRAN, MAVEN, CommNet, DyMA-CL, and G2ANet on SMAC, the decentralised micromanagement scenario of StarCraft II